India's Forex Reserves Plunge by USD 6.7 Billion to USD 717.06 Billion

  • India's forex reserves dropped by USD 6.711 billion to USD 717.064 billion in the week ended February 6.
  • This follows a record high of USD 723.774 billion in the previous reporting week.
  • Foreign currency assets increased by USD 7.661 billion to USD 570.053 billion.
  • The value of gold reserves decreased by USD 14.208 billion to USD 123.476 billion.
  • Special Drawing Rights (SDRs) and India’s reserve position with the IMF also saw declines.
